1948 Austin A 90 vs. 1972 Lamborghini Jarama

To start off, 1972 Lamborghini Jarama is newer by 24 year(s). Which means there will be less support and parts availability for 1948 Austin A 90. In addition, the cost of maintenance, including insurance, on 1948 Austin A 90 would be higher. At 3,929 cc (12 cylinders), 1972 Lamborghini Jarama is equipped with a bigger engine. In terms of performance, 1972 Lamborghini Jarama (365 HP @ 7500 RPM) has 278 more horse power than 1948 Austin A 90. (87 HP @ 4000 RPM) In normal driving conditions, 1972 Lamborghini Jarama should accelerate faster than 1948 Austin A 90. With that said, vehicle weight also plays an important factor in acceleration. 1948 Austin A 90 weights approximately 20 kg more than 1972 Lamborghini Jarama.

Both vehicles are rear wheel drive (RWD) - it offers better handling in dry conditions; in addition, if you are looking to drift, both vehicles do the job better than front wheel drive vehicles. With that said, do keep in mind that many other factors such as speed and the wear on your tires can also have significant impact on traction and control. Let's talk about torque, 1972 Lamborghini Jarama (407 Nm @ 5500 RPM) has 217 more torque (in Nm) than 1948 Austin A 90. (190 Nm @ 2500 RPM). This means 1972 Lamborghini Jarama will have an easier job in driving up hills or pulling heavy equipment than 1948 Austin A 90.

Compare all specifications:

1948 Austin A 90 1972 Lamborghini Jarama
Make Austin Lamborghini
Model A 90 Jarama
Year Released 1948 1972
Engine Position Front Front
Engine Size 2660 cc 3929 cc
Engine Cylinders 4 cylinders 12 cylinders
Engine Type in-line V
Valves per Cylinder 2 valves 2 valves
Horse Power 87 HP 365 HP
Engine RPM 4000 RPM 7500 RPM
Torque 190 Nm 407 Nm
Torque RPM 2500 RPM 5500 RPM
Engine Compression Ratio 7.5:1 10.7:1
Drive Type Rear Rear
Transmission Type Manual Manual
Number of Seats 4 seats 2 seats
Number of Doors 3 doors 2 doors
Vehicle Weight 1360 kg 1340 kg
Vehicle Length 4520 mm 4490 mm
Vehicle Width 1780 mm 1830 mm
Vehicle Height 1530 mm 1200 mm
Wheelbase Size 2440 mm 2380 mm
